Output 2937c35bea218a717a91a3c19d323d14aa283e3763784b3cc1734b0ee9a79023:2

value
26729538
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46c374ea62fbf3a8b92c08dabe3edaa4b0e6eb12 OP_EQUALVERIFY OP_CHECKSIG
address
17TASzshbhv58kGs729kPxHDtZ6GHb5tor
transaction
2937c35bea218a717a91a3c19d323d14aa283e3763784b3cc1734b0ee9a79023
spent
true